               TITLE 22--FOREIGN RELATIONS AND INTERCOURSE
 
                     CHAPTER 58--DIPLOMATIC SECURITY
 
               SUBCHAPTER IV--DIPLOMATIC SECURITY PROGRAM
 
Sec. 4860. Reimbursement of Department of the Treasury

    The Secretary of State shall reimburse the appropriate 
appropriations account of the Department of the Treasury out of funds 
appropriated pursuant to section 4851(a)(1) of this title for the actual 
costs incurred by the United States Secret Service, as agreed to by the 
Secretary of the Treasury, for providing protection for the spouses of 
foreign heads of state during fiscal years 1986 and 1987.

(Pub. L. 99-399, title IV, Sec. 411, Aug. 27, 1986, 100 Stat. 867.)
